On Jan. 15, 2024, a powerful explosive eruption from the underwater volcano Hunga Tonga Hunga Ha-apai lofted volcanic ash and gas high into the stratosphere and sent atmospheric shockwaves and tsunami waves around the world. The eruption brought powerful tsunami waves and heavy ashfall to islands in the nation of Tonga ... Web12 dec. 2024 · According to the US Geological Survey, there have been at least 97 tsunamis in Indonesia since 1883. The most devastating tsunami in Indonesia occurred in 2004. The tsunami was caused by an earthquake off the coast of Sumatra. More than 230,000 people were killed or went missing.

Web15 jul. 2009 · There have been over fifty recorded incidents of tsunamis affecting the Australian coastline since European settlement. Most of these tsunamis have resulted in dangerous rips and currents rather than land inundation. The largest tsunami impacts have been recorded along the northwest coast of Western Australia:
